Overall Satisfaction with IBM Connections
We currently use IBM Connections as a backend platform. We have built a custom platform (member-facing) on top of IBM Connections. Our member-facing platform currently serving over 100,000 members. Our main use of IBM Connections is for the collaboration tools that it offers.
- Easy to set up communities
- Easy to customize communities and add/delete different widgets
- Easy to navigate
- We have had some difficulty in bridging IBM Connections with several other applications (security mainly)
- I would like to be able to customize and name the widgets to match up with our member-facing tool (ie. IBM Connections calls it a "blog," whereas our member-facing application calls this area "news."
- Ease of collaboration between members (100K+)
- Ease of setting of communities of practice very quickly
